Overall Meaning

The song "Secret" by Hurshel appears to be about a deep connection between two individuals who share similar temperaments. Throughout the song, the artist addresses the other person's temper and reveals their own likeness to it. The repeated lines "You are losing temper-temper" and "You know why I got your back do you? 'Cause I'm like you" suggest a familiarity with the other person's emotional state and a willingness to support them through it.


The chorus asks the other person to reveal what they're hiding in their heart, as the artist claims to have already seen it and that it's not a secret. They suggest running away together, as if their connection is something that can't be contained or ignored.


The artist also expresses an attraction to the other person, admiring the way they laugh and noting how they tempt them to break the rules. Despite the intensity of their connection, there is an element of uncertainty in the lyrics, as if the artist is unsure if the other person truly shares their feelings.


Overall, the lyrics of "Secret" suggest a complex relationship between two people who share a deep, emotional connection. The repeated lines about losing temper and having each other's backs create a sense of intimacy and understanding, while the chorus hints at a desire to escape and be completely honest with one another.
